Colleges and Universities
Fayetteville State University - As the first state-supported school for African-Americans in the South, FSU has a proud heritage.Today, the
university has a diverse student body of over 6,500 enrolled in 43 undergraduate programs, 23 master's degree programs, and a doctoral degree program in Educational Leadership. FSU is part of the University of North Carolina system. 1200 Murchison Rd. (910) 672-1111/ 800-222-2594.
Fayetteville Technical Community College - North Carolina's second-largest community college offers certificates, diplomas and associate degrees in over 65 programs. College transfer credits can be earned in curriculum plans including business and health, as well as technical and vocational courses. The Continuing Education Division offers classes at various locations throughout the community. 2201 Hull Rd. (910) 678-8400.
Methodist University - Over 2,000 students are enrolled in this four-year, private, liberal arts college which offers 45 degree programs in the arts and sciences, including golf management and a recently-established physician's assistant course of study. 5400 Ramsey St. (910) 630-7000/800-488-7110.

Campbell University - Campbell is a coeducational, church-related university located in central North Carolina. Students are enrolled from all counties, with most states along the Atlantic Seaboard represented in the student body. Students from more than forty-five foreign countries
regularly attend Campbell. The distribution of male and female students is almost equal. The climate in Buies Creek is mild with the

opportunity for outdoor sports throughout the year. P.O. Box 488 Buies Creek, NC 27506. 1-800-334-4111.
